mod_rewrite with exceptions

apache, mod-rewrite

Solution

Try something like this:

RewriteCond %{SERVER_PORT} 80 
RewriteCond %{REQUEST_URI} !/page1/test
RewriteCond %{REQUEST_URI} !/page2
RewriteRule ^(.*)$ https://mywebsite.com/$1 [R,L]

Problem

For redirecting every request on my server to a secure connection I use ``` RewriteCond %{SERVER_PORT} 80 RewriteRule ^(.*)$ https://mywebsite.com/$1 [R,L] ``` which works perfect. However I need two paths not to be redirected. Say when I access ``` http://www.mywebsite.com/page1/test http://www.mywebsite.com/page2 ``` I want to go to exactly that path. Is that possible with mod_rewrite?
